Read moreMont des Arts Garden is a beautiful public garden located in the heart of Brussels, Belgium. The garden is situated on the hillside that overlooks the city and is known for its stunning panoramic views of Brussels.
The garden was originally designed in the early 20th century as part of a larger urban development project, and it has since become one of the most popular public spaces in the city. The garden features a range of beautiful flowers, plants, and trees, as well as a number of sculptures and fountains.
One of the most impressive features of Mont des Arts Garden is its formal French design, which is characterized by symmetrical patterns and ornate flower beds. The garden is particularly beautiful in the spring and summer months, when the flowers are in full bloom and the colors are at their most vibrant.
Mont des Arts Garden is also home to a number of important cultural institutions, including the Royal Museums of Fine Arts of Belgium, the Royal Library of Belgium, and the Musical Instruments Museum. Read moreMont des Arts is an urban leisure area that includes a very nice garden area as well as the Royal Library of Belgium (KBR), Square Brussels and the National Archives of Belgium. It extends from Place de l'Albertine to Coudenberg.
Most visitors likely visit here to see the hillside garden which is nicely landscaped with shrubs, trees and numerous monuments, fountain as well as a delightful Carillon. Unfortunately, the grounds can be quite trashy first thing in the morning but when clean, this is a nice public garden with good views and monument viewing.
